How much does it cost to rent an apartment in San Antonio?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
San Antonio Studio Apartments | $1,154 | $405 | $3,704 |
San Antonio 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,306 | $480 | $6,037 |
San Antonio 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,707 | $295 | $10,000+ |
San Antonio 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,191 | $337 | $10,000+ |
San Antonio 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,211 | $715 | $10,000+ |
San Antonio 5 Bedroom Apartments | $7,667 | $799 | $10,000+ |

Rhonda • 4+ years in San Antonio
February 25, 2025There are so many positive things to list about San Antonio. It is crazy affordable for a large city with so much to see and do in addition to the RiverWalk. Childcare and veterinary care is reasonable. There are housing options for both rentals and purchasing. The restaurant scene is impressive, including trendy small plates and established community favorites. The traffic is not the best, but it is a big, sprawling city.
